Citroen C4 Picasso five-seat
Mon, 29 Jan 2007This is the new five-seat version of the C4 Picasso following the seven-seat model shown at the Paris Motor Show, which will now to be known as the Grand C4 Picasso. Naturally enough then, the two cars will compete with the standard and Grand Renault Scenics, the new Citroen C4 Picasso also tackling the handsome Volkswagen Golf Plus. The C4 Picasso shares its front half with its bigger stablemate while the rear has become more fastback in style, blackened pillars and dipping beltline also reminding of the Citroen C-Sportlounge concept.
Finalists announced in exterior phase of CDN-GM Interactive Design competition
Thu, 24 Nov 2011The exterior phase of the CDN-GM Interactive Design competition closed on the November 7th, with over 150 entries from design students based in the USA and Canada, making it our most popular interactive competition phase so far. After the press days of the recent LA Auto Show, judges and mentors from GM, along with our competition partners Dassault Systèmes, Faurecia and SRG Global, gathered at GM's North Hollywood advanced design studio to pick the finalists. Those chosen will be invited to attend the 2012 NAIAS in Detroit, along with finalists from the interiors phase, and on the second press day, interiors and exterior winners will be announced for each brand.
Aston Martins voted 'best status symbol'
Mon, 04 Aug 2014AN ASTON Martin is the car to be seen driving if you want people to believe you've 'made it', according to an offbeat new study. Research carried out by Auto Trader among 1,024 drivers showed that the British brand's cars are, perhaps unsurprisingly, the ones that most Brits think highest of, beating the likes of Ferrari, Lamborghini and Bentley down the order. In fact, the top three positions in the survey were filled by British car makers, with Bentley and Rolls Royce second and third respectively.
